Foundation Leak Water Removal Cost In Willow Grove, PA

Prices for foundation le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Willow Grove, PA. These estimates are based on industry standards and may not reflect your specific situation. Get a free estimate to find out the cost of your specific project.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s
Drying and dehumidification $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s
Final inspection and cleanup $100 – $500 Size of affected area and labor costs
Insurance claims help Free – $500 Complexity of claims process and labor costs
